Nollywood star and former wife of Ghanaian actor Chris Attoh, Damilola Adegbite has taken to her page to beseeched married couples married for long to share their secrets.
Marriage is an institution blessed by God but some couples have had a fair share of the drama that comes with marriages. While others have survived their marriages with their partner other marriages have been crushed for different reasons..




Actress Damolo Adegbite is one of the actresses whose marriage with Ghanaian actor Chris Attoh was crushed a few years after their union. The former couple since their break up did not make their issues public. Their divorce did not come with any dramatic scene like other celebrities who have caused drama on social media.

In a recent interview with media personality Chude, Damilola Adegbite spoke about her divorce and disclosed that sometimes love in a marriage is not enough.

In a recent post sighted on the page of Damilola, she beseeched married couples married for long years to share their secrets and also brag about their marriages.

She wrote, “I don’t think we hear enough about happy marriages. Marriages that continue to pass the tests of time. All we hear about are the ones that didn’t work. Please if you have been happily married for at least 5 years and you see this message on your timeline, please brag to me. Tell us what has kept you and your partner together this far.

“If you know any happily married couples (emphasis on HAPPILY), please tag them too. Tell us how you and your partner keep the flame burning 💕I met a couple who have been married for 9 years and it was as if I should join the union. They couldn’t keep their eyes and hands off each other! It was too sweet to watch! Please share your secrets! 💕💕💕”.
